Show GIRL STRIKERS RECEIVE DONATIONS AKRON PUBLIC GIVES TO THE CAUSE i ! I . -"" t Alluule 0tIJU and Datj Kuja. Akron, O , March 3 Refusal to re- instate any of the rubber strikers I who have identified themselves with the present strike organization or continue to remain members of the I W W. is a part of tho fight to the finish program by which rubber fac- tory ofricials hope to break tho present pres-ent strike of 12.000 workers and resume- operation of the factories at the old scale of wages Strikers say all the larger factories facto-ries have had spotters among them recording the namc-s or those who are taking an actiTfl pan iu the strike. The organization or the I W W, teller committee has been practically! completed and a large number ol strikers ure being cared for througb the efforts of this committee. Collections Col-lections are being taken at many of the public meetings in the parks and I the strikers assert that the response has been liberal, m.iu v donations be - I ing received froi workers who are not 1 on strike ' Among the girl strikers are Miss Palsy Kays and Miss Minnie Btrt-, Btrt-, schl. who Joined the I Y YY more-I more-I meut. they sard, because thev could i not earn euough to support" themselves them-selves beyond a bare existence Both girls say they did not average more than 80 cents a day and were em-j ployed making rubber shoes. Since I they have teen living at the homes J; of friends and say they will stay out t forever if the increase in wages ask- ed by the scale committee is not granted.
